The Global Commercial & Industrial Racking Paradigm

As supply chains shift toward rapid local fulfillment, high-density warehousing configurations have progressed from simple storage layouts to core strategic assets. Historically, storage systems were considered static cost centers. Today, global enterprises leverage advanced heavy-duty structural steel racking systems to unlock micro-fulfillment capabilities, reduce spatial footprints, and enhance automated storage and retrieval system (AS/RS) integration.

Increasing urban land costs in major logistics hubs across North America, Western Europe, and Southeast Asia demand space-efficient structural profiles. High-bay pallet racking systems and dynamic shuttle mechanisms provide optimized spatial efficiency, reducing warehouse footprint footprints by up to 60% while doubling inventory density. As global distributors adopt multi-tiered configurations, selecting the correct structural specification becomes critical for both operational compliance and structural safety.

Localized Application Scenarios & Environmental Adaptation

Industrial racking solutions engineered for localized regional demand, geographic anomalies, and seismic ratings.

High-Seismic Zones (US West Coast / Japan)

Structures engineered using Finite Element Analysis (FEA) to endure horizontal peak ground acceleration. Features custom baseplates, reinforced anchor bolts, and heavier vertical bracing systems conforming to ASCE 7 and RMI specifications.

Cold Chain & Sub-Zero Storage

Engineered for operating environments down to -30°C. Sanyang utilizes high-toughness steel grades that prevent low-temperature brittleness, treated with specialized epoxy-polyester powder coats to mitigate oxidation in high-humidity thaw cycles.

Automated E-Commerce Fulfillment

Optimized vertical clearances and flat shelving profiles design to integrate with robotic AMRs (Autonomous Mobile Robots) and AGVs, enabling maximum storage capacity and pick speed efficiency.

Localized Compliance & Regulatory Standard Support

How Sanyang guarantees structural safety and legal compliance within destination markets.

North America (RMI / ANSI / OSHA)

Our products comply with RMI (Rack Manufacturers Institute) standard MH16.1. We provide load plaques, weld inspection reports, and seismic calculations required by local engineering departments.

Europe (FEM / EN Standards)

Fully compliant with FEM 10.2.02 design guidelines and EN 15512 standards for steel static storage systems. Certified CE compliance is standard for all structural structural steel components.

Middle East & APAC (Civil Defense)

High-durability structures engineered to resist high ambient temperatures and humidity. Sanyang products are verified for civil defense structural compliance and warehouse safety regulations.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Expert answers to questions on load limits, seismic engineering, and global logistics configuration.

Q: What raw material standards does Sanyang use for heavy-duty systems?
A: Sanyang primarily utilizes cold-rolled structural steel grades Q235B and Q355B, corresponding to ASTM A36 and ASTM A572 respectively. All raw materials receive mill test certifications checking chemical composition and yield strengths prior to manufacturing.
Q: How does Sanyang assist overseas buyers with local building permits?
A: We provide detailed technical specifications, AutoCAD layouts, and Finite Element Analysis (FEA) structural reports. If required, we collaborate with localized structural engineers to supply PE stamps and seismic calculations satisfying municipal codes.
Q: What finishes are available for corrosion protection?
A: We offer thermo-hardening epoxy-polyester powder coating for standard dry storage, specialized anti-microbial coatings for medical facilities, and hot-dip galvanized structural steel for outdoor applications or humid cold storage units.
